Pregunta

Actualmente, tengo una pieza de la tela conectada que consume una lista de SharePoint y utiliza los datos para añadir ubicaciones a un control de mapa de Google.

Lo que me gustaría hacer es utilizar el control de Bing Maps Silverlight y utilizar los mismos datos para hacer pasadores en el mapa. Puedo crear una pieza de la tela sin conectar y utilizar los servicios web de SharePoint para acceder a los datos de la lista, recorrer las filas y añadir los pasadores al mapa. En términos de configuración, esto significará que el usuario tendrá que introducir el nombre de la lista (o GUID) en las propiedades de la pieza de la tela, mientras que antes de que pudieran elegir entre las listas disponibles en el sitio, esto parece ser un paso en la dirección equivocada .

Entonces, ¿hay una manera de utilizar los datos que se proporcionan por el elemento web conectado y que esté disponible para el control de Silverlight?

Cheers, Stuart.

¿Fue útil?

Solución

¿Se puede modificar el elemento web de Google existente para producir el código javascript apropiado para su elemento web de Silverlight? Se puede ver un ejemplo de la Bing JavaScript produce a través de una parte vista de datos web en mi serie Maps .

Otros consejos

La lista elemento Web de vista es sólo un consumidor de conexión y no un proveedor. Usted podría subclase del ListViewWebPart y añadir un proveedor de conexión personalizada a ella con la lista actual de identificación.

Licenciado bajo: CC-BY-SA con atribución
scroll top